Transaction fae35cdd42046f5a3fb12a99f55bece962d150ce1a02d984cb41a118a645057a

100 Input
1 Outputs
  • fae35cdd42046f5a3fb12a99f55bece962d150ce1a02d984cb41a118a645057a:0
  • value  1512457487
    address  1GrwDkr33gT6LuumniYjKEGjTLhsL5kmqC